About the Artist
John and Sharon Knowles met in Scotland in 1990. They played in a local band together and later as a duo, performing all over Scotland and in parts of Ireland. They married in 1997 and John brought Sharon to live in the USA. They lived in North Carolina for three years, performing at various festivals and breaking new ground by adding a Highland Dancer to their group. John and Sharon now live in the DC area and continue to perform and teach.

Product Description
Traditional Scottish and Irish music played on harp and fiddle. Other instruments include mandolin, mandola, concertina, whislte, banjo and bodhran.

5 out of 5 stars Excellent traditional Scottish and Irish music.......2001-01-31

This is an excellent cd, displaying Sharons brilliant virtuosity on the clarsach and Irish harp, and John's light and sensitive fiddle playing. The slower Scottish tracks particularly shine, especially the exceptional "Neil Gow's lament for the Death of his Second Wife". The O'Carolan tracks are also particularly evocative, demonstrating Sharon's excellent and emotive use of the low bass strings.

John also demonstrates his virtuosity on several other instruments, although it has to be said that his fiddle playing shines out as his finest achievement.

I heartily reccomend this cd to anyone who has a particular love of traditional Scottish music, played as it should be. Well done John and Sharon!
